Release : 2022 APR 03
- 
					
					
					
					
Release : 2022 APR 03
There's a new release of JSCAD, including changes from several pull requests.
Features
3mf-serializer: new serializer from JSCAD geometry to 3MF packages
Bug Fixes
modeling: corrected ellipse and ellipsoid manifolds
modeling: fix assignHoles function when there are nested holes
modeling: fixed areAllShapesTheSameType and add a test
modeling: fixed cylinder construction, enhanced to support zero radius
web: editor styling and example loading fixesThanks to @NilsKrause for the very nice fix to the WEB UI editor
Thanks to @platypii for the improvements to the modeling librarySuccessfully published:
- @jscad/cli@2.2.18
 - @jscad/core@2.5.8
 - @jscad/examples@2.3.3
 - @jscad/3mf-serializer@2.1.1
 - @jscad/amf-deserializer@2.2.10
 - @jscad/amf-serializer@2.1.7
 - @jscad/dxf-deserializer@2.3.14
 - @jscad/dxf-serializer@2.1.7
 - @jscad/io-utils@2.0.17
 - @jscad/io@2.3.1
 - @jscad/json-deserializer@2.0.18
 - @jscad/json-serializer@2.0.17
 - @jscad/obj-deserializer@2.0.17
 - @jscad/obj-serializer@2.1.7
 - @jscad/stl-deserializer@2.1.14
 - @jscad/stl-serializer@2.1.7
 - @jscad/svg-deserializer@2.4.10
 - @jscad/svg-serializer@2.3.5
 - @jscad/x3d-deserializer@2.1.4
 - @jscad/x3d-serializer@2.3.7
 - @jscad/modeling@2.9.2
 - @jscad/array-utils@2.1.3
 - @jscad/img-utils@2.0.4
 - @jscad/regl-renderer@2.5.8
 - @jscad/vtree@2.0.18
 - @jscad/web@2.5.8
 
lerna success published 26 packages